Inside Abyssea, provided you're using Voracious Violet and a regain Moonshade Earring (Assuming 2 tics of regain for 6 tp), you can use this set on your tp phase:



Then the only stp pieces you need to keep on during weaponskill are Rajas Ring, Brutal Earring and Rose Strap (obviously).
It'll come out to 100.2 tp going from WS + 4 hits to WS. Going from 0 tp to WS (switching from proc weapon to Ukon) 5 hits will yield 101.5 tp.

This allows you to keep your haste capped with 26% visible. It does however leave no room for error on your WS as you will need to land both hits or else you'll fall exactly 1 tp short if the second hit misses. Obviously if you miss the first hit, you'd be screwed anyway. Another option since you can drop 4stp from a perfect full stp build (52 stp possible as /sam with Moonshade in second ear slot - I chose to drop hoard in my set) is to keep Hoard Ring and drop White Tathlum and Almah Torque for Ravager's Orb and Ravager's Gorget. Not actually sure which would be better tbh.

If you have e body, some good augments on it would do better than ravager's for tp. For mdt, shell5 with cpaped merits is 27% mdt, so your set has much more mdt than it needs. I would go for ironram body+shadow ring which would put you at 23% mdt.
